No Major Damage From Lee in Southwest Nova Scotia

Above: Extra lines help keep boats at the Falls Point wharf in Woods Harbour safely tied up during post-tropical storm Lee. Kathy Johnson photo   Aside from some coastal erosion and downed trees, post-tropical storm Lee’s bite wasn’t as bad as its bark when it blew through southwestern Nova Scotia on Sept. 16.
